Directions for Use

Directions for use: Take the contents of 1 strip (4 packets) with food. Strip may be consumed at once or spread throughout the day.

Warnings & Precautions

Contains: Omega-3 fatty acids derived from fish (sardines, herring, mackerel and/or menhaden) and glucosamine, an ingredient derived from crustacean shellfish (crab, lobster or shrimp).

Caution: Do not take more than the contents of one strip per day.

If you are pregnant or nursing, or if under the age of 18, please seek the advice of a healthcare professional before using this product.

If you are pregnant or nursing, or if under the age of 18, please seek the advice of a healthcare professional before using this product.

Don't take this product with any other Coreplex products including MNS Systems.

Keep out of reach of children: In case of accidental overdose, seek professional assistance or contact a poison control center immediately.
